Cape Girardeau police investigate fatal shooting

CAPE GIRARDEAU, Mo., (KBSI) — Police responded to a report of shots fired Friday at a residence in the 1500-block of Whitener, where they found one person with a non-life-threatening gunshot wound to the leg.

A second victim, 22-year-old Micah Ledbetter, of Cape Girardeau, arrived at a hospital with a gunshot wound and later died.

The Cape Girardeau/Bollinger County Major Case Squad was activated and identified Deandra Leeann Patterson, 27, of Cape Girardeau, as a suspect.

Patterson was charged with second-degree murder, armed criminal action and unlawful possession of a firearm. She is being held on a $1 million cash-only bond. It was found Patterson had a self-inflicted gun shot wound.

Police say they are confident all suspects connected to the homicide are in custody and no further arrests are anticipated.
